On Tuesday, Away launched its newest collection: Softside. Softside marks the luggage brand's first foray into a full soft-sided luggage collection.

The new Softside collection is designed to be as durable, lightweight and stylish as its hard-sided counterpart. It has all of the features you already love about Away, plus a few new ones. Each piece of Softside luggage is constructed with high-strength, water-resistant nylon that can withstand frequent use while providing a bit of flexibility when you want to squeeze in just one more outfit for your trip.

Softside bags are available in four colors — jet black, cloud gray, coast blue and clay pink — across each of Away's original luggage sizes:
- Softside Carry-On ($225): Holds five to seven outfits and fits in the overhead bin of most major U.S. airlines (21.9 inches by 15 inches by 9.1 inches).
- Softside Bigger Carry-On ($245): Holds six to nine outfits and fits in the overhead bin on most major U.S. airlines (23 inches by 15.7 inches by 9.1 inches).
- Softside Medium ($295): Holds 10-13 outfits and must be checked for air travel (26 inches by 18.9 inches by 10.6 inches).
- Softside Large ($325): Holds 15-19 outfits and must be checked for air travel (28.7 inches by 21.5 inches by 11.8 inches).
Luggage in the Softside collection is also outfitted with a Transportation Security Administration-compliant combination lock, a polyester laundry bag, 360-degree spinning wheels, a black leather luggage tag, and interior and exterior pockets for organization. Each piece also has a wraparound zipper that allows you to expand the suitcase when you need additional packing space.
The exterior pockets are sized to fit items you need easy access to, like your laptop, tablet and other essentials. Two smaller interior mesh pockets are built into the compression system. There's also a large mesh pocket within the suitcase's lid.
Some travelers prefer soft-sided luggage over hard-sided luggage for its flexibility, lighter weight and capacity. Away's Softside collection delivers all of these, plus the durability and functionality Away luggage has provided for years.
